AdvoCare's Family and Youth Defense Fund is established as a legal defense
fund using AdvoCare's current tax exempt status and charitable purpose under their Family Bound program. The purpose
of the fund would be to provide assistance in general actions, individual cases, or for filing amicus briefs where the
outcome of such cases may effect our members and the general public in areas related to our organizations charitable purpose,
goals, and description of activities. The fund, and all donations to the fund, would be governed and administered under
the direction of AdvoCare's Board of Directors.

Advocare is a non-profit, membership organization that is part of a national effort to reduce crime through criminal
justice reform.
The Literacy, Education, and Rehabilitation Advocacy Campaign is our way of educating the
general public as well as public officials on how to implement overall literacy and rehabilitation programs that are designed
to reduce prison populations, crime, and the overall cost of corrections.
The Family Bound program will focus on ideas that pertain
to keeping families united and children directed away from bad behavior that may later lead to criminal acts, substance abuse,
and violence. It is our intent to analyze ways of strengthening families and promoting positive development for young
people that may, in fact, require rethinking the norms of our modern society.

Give Judges A Choice
The Give Judges A Choice project will expand on ways
to empower judges with tools that can lead to alternative sentences, especially for youth and substance abusers. Many in the
judiciary feel like they are given few alternatives between prison and setting someone free. We will research new ideas that
provide options which make for more constructive alternatives.
